[Scummvm-cvs-logs] SF.net SVN: scummvm: [26678] scummvm/trunk/engines/scumm/boxes.cpp

fingolfin at users.sourceforge.net fingolfin at users.sourceforge.net
Sun Apr 29 20:22:08 CEST 2007


Revision: 26678
          http://scummvm.svn.sourceforge.net/scummvm/?rev=26678&view=rev
Author:   fingolfin
Date:     2007-04-29 11:22:07 -0700 (Sun, 29 Apr 2007)

Log Message:
-----------
Change getNumBoxes() to properly read the full uint16 box count (shouldn't affect anything, though)

Modified Paths:
--------------
    scummvm/trunk/engines/scumm/boxes.cpp

Modified: scummvm/trunk/engines/scumm/boxes.cpp
===================================================================
--- scummvm/trunk/engines/scumm/boxes.cpp	2007-04-29 14:06:46 UTC (rev 26677)
+++ scummvm/trunk/engines/scumm/boxes.cpp	2007-04-29 18:22:07 UTC (rev 26678)
@@ -443,7 +443,9 @@
 	if (!ptr)
 		return 0;
 	if (_game.version == 8)
-		return (byte) READ_LE_UINT32(ptr);
+		return (byte)READ_LE_UINT32(ptr);
+	else if (_game.features >= 5)
+		return (byte)READ_LE_UINT16(ptr);
 	else
 		return ptr[0];
 }


This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site.




More information about the Scummvm-git-logs mailing list